Leon's

>
>
>
Denton

Leon's stores & openning hours in Denton

Leon's - Denton

111 E University Dr, #108, Denton, TX 76209

Leon's - Denton

111 E University Dr, Ste 108, Denton, TX 76209

Leon's - Denton

526 N Locust St, #5, Denton, TX 76201

Leon's locations & hours near Denton

16 miles

Leon's - Frisco

3388 W Main St, Ste 300, Frisco, TX 75033
16 miles

Leon's - Frisco

3388 Main St, Ste 300, Frisco, TX 75033
18 miles

Leon's - Southlake

950 E State Highway 114, Ste 100, Southlake, TX 76092
19 miles

Leon's - Southlake

900 E Southlake Blvd, Ste 300, Southlake, TX 76092
21 miles

Leon's - Plano

6300 W Parker Rd, Ste 426, Plano, TX 75093
22 miles

Leon's - Plano

2500 Dallas Pkwy, Ste 260, Plano, TX 75093
22 miles

Leon's - Grapevine

3600 William D Tate Ave, #100, Grapevine, TX 76051
23 miles

Leon's - Plano

5025 W Park Blvd, Ste 500, Plano, TX 75093
24 miles

Leon's - Dallas

17440 Dallas Pkwy, Dallas, TX 75287
24 miles

Leon's - Addison

16775 Addison Rd, Addison, TX 75001
24 miles

Leon's - Plano

4708 Alliance Blvd, #725, Plano, TX 75093
25 miles

Leon's - Dallas

12895 Josey Ln, Ste 100, Dallas, TX 75234

Leon's - Texas

Number of stores: 565
State: Texas change state



Leon's jobs in Texas